[자료구조 자료구조] 선택정렬 - 단계별 보임

등록일 2003.11.04 C언어 (cpp) | 2페이지 | 가격 300원

목차

정렬의 가장 기본이 되는 선택 정렬 입니다.
임의의 수 N개를 생성해서 정렬 하는 과정과 정렬된 결과를 보여줍니다.

본문내용

#include <stdio.h>
#include <stdlib.h>
#include <time.h>

#define N 10

void SelectionSort(int A[], int n);
void Swap (int *,int *);

void main()
{
int i, A[N];

srand((unsigned)time(NULL));

printf("초기 값 : ");

for ( i = 0; i < N; i++ )
{
A[i] = rand() % 100;
*원하는 자료를 검색 해 보세요.
  • [실습2]수행시간측정 4 페이지
    ○ 실습 문제 소개 피보나치 수열 알고리즘과 버블 정렬 알고리즘을 프로그램으로 구현하고, 입력 크기를 바꾸어 가며 수행 시간을 측정하여 비교 분석한다. 입력크기를 1~10까지 변경하며 프로그램 수행 시간을 측정하고, ..
  • [ 알고리즘 ] Heap Sort 소스 코딩 3 페이지
    #include <stdlib.h> #include <stdio.h> #include <time.h> #define max 9 void heapsort(); void Heap_print(); int n = 8..
  • 선택정렬 이진탐색 8 페이지
    <이진탐색> 이진탐색은 n>=1개의 서로 다른 정수가 이미 정렬되어 배열에 저장되어 있을때 x=a[j]인 x가 존재하면 j를 반환하고 그렇지 않으면 -1을 반환하여 정수를 찾았는지 몇 번째에서 찾았는지를 알수 있습니다. ..
  • [자료구조] 정렬 알고리즘 종류 9 페이지
    2. 삽입 정렬(insertion sort) ① 삽입 정렬 개념 - 삽입정렬은 매우 간단한 정렬 방법으로 소량의 자료를 처리하는데 유용 - 파일을 구성하고 있는 부파일(subfile)의 레코드들이 이미 정렬이 되어 있다..
  • [자료구조] 정렬 알고리즘 간의 정렬 실행시간 및 정렬 속도 비교 레포트 16 페이지
    기수정렬은? 기수 정렬은 레코드를 비교하지 않고도 정렬하는 방법이다. 버켓을 만들어서 입력 데이터를 각 자릿수의 값에 따라 버켓에 넣는다. 그리고 위에서부터 아래로 순차적으로 버켓안에 들어 있는 숫자들을 읽음으로써 정렬된..
      최근 구매한 회원 학교정보 보기
      1. 최근 2주간 다운받은 회원수와 학교정보이며
         구매한 본인의 구매정보도 함께 표시됩니다.
      2. 매시 정각마다 업데이트 됩니다. (02:00 ~ 21:00)
      3. 구매자의 학교정보가 없는 경우 기타로 표시됩니다.
      최근 본 자료더보기
      추천도서